Creative Games Online: Unlocking Imagination Through Play

creative games online have revolutionized the way people engage with digital entertainment, merging imagination, innovation, and interactive fun in ways that traditional games often can’t match. Whether you’re a casual player, an educator, or a parent looking for enriching activities, creative games online offer a dynamic playground for expressing ideas, solving problems, and building new skills. Unlike competitive or purely action-oriented games, these titles emphasize creativity, customization, and exploration, making them a unique category of digital experiences that appeal to all ages.

What Are Creative Games Online?

Creative games online are a genre of digital games that focus on creativity, design, and open-ended gameplay rather than linear objectives or score-based challenges. These games allow players to build worlds, craft stories, design characters, or solve puzzles through inventive thinking. Examples range from sandbox games like Minecraft to art-focused platforms such as Drawful or even music creation apps integrated into gaming.

The appeal lies in the freedom these games grant players to express themselves. Instead of following strict rules or predefined paths, you are often invited to experiment, innovate, and let your imagination run wild. This makes creative games not only entertaining but also powerful tools for learning and development.

Popular Genres and Examples of Creative Games Online

Creative gaming spans multiple genres, each catering to different creative impulses and skill sets. Some of the most influential categories include sandbox games, simulation titles, and puzzle-based construction games.

Sandbox and Open-World Builders

Sandbox games epitomize the creative genre by offering unrestricted environments where players can build, explore, and experiment. Titles such as Minecraft have become cultural landmarks, providing voxel-based worlds that can be reshaped with limitless possibilities. Minecraft’s success lies in its simplicity combined with depth, enabling everything from architectural masterpieces to complex redstone circuits simulating electrical systems.

Other notable sandbox experiences include Roblox, a platform that not only lets users play games but also create and monetize their own interactive experiences using a proprietary game development system. This has led to a thriving ecosystem where creativity meets entrepreneurship.

Simulation and Design Games

Simulation games often immerse players in realistic or fantastical systems, challenging them to design, manage, or optimize environments. Games like The Sims series allow users to create and control virtual lives, blending storytelling with architectural and social creativity. Similarly, city-building games such as Cities: Skylines emphasize urban planning and resource management, requiring players to creatively solve logistical challenges.

These games appeal to those interested in design, strategy, and narrative crafting, offering a sandbox for human behavior modeling and aesthetic experimentation.

Puzzle and Logic-Based Creative Games

Puzzle games with creative elements encourage players to construct solutions using limited components or physics-based mechanics. Titles like LittleBigPlanet combine platforming with level creation, where players design intricate stages and share them online. Portal 2’s puzzle editor also exemplifies this approach, providing tools to craft spatial challenges that test logic and ingenuity.

These games highlight creativity in problem-solving and spatial reasoning, expanding the definition of what creative gameplay entails.

Technological Innovations Driving Creative Games Online

The evolution of creative games online is closely tied to technological advancements that lower barriers to creation and enhance interactivity. Cloud computing, improved graphics engines, and accessible development tools have democratized game design, enabling users with minimal programming knowledge to contribute meaningfully.

Game Engines and User-Friendly Creation Tools

Platforms such as Unity and Unreal Engine offer intuitive interfaces and extensive asset libraries, making it easier for developers and players alike to build complex game worlds. Many creative games now incorporate simplified editors that abstract technical complexity, allowing users to focus on design rather than code.

Additionally, scripting languages embedded within games, like Lua in Roblox, provide flexible yet manageable ways to customize gameplay, further empowering creative expression.

Multiplayer and Social Integration

Creative games online thrive on social connectivity. Multiplayer features and online sharing capabilities transform solitary creation into communal experiences. Players collaborate on projects, critique designs, and participate in creative challenges, fostering vibrant communities.

Social media integration and streaming platforms have amplified this effect by enabling creators to showcase their work to broader audiences, sometimes leading to monetization opportunities.

Challenges and Considerations in Creative Games Online

Despite their appeal, creative games online face certain challenges. The open-ended nature can lead to overwhelming complexity for newcomers, necessitating user-friendly tutorials and guidance. Additionally, content moderation becomes critical as user-generated content can sometimes be inappropriate or infringe on intellectual property rights.

Monetization models also raise questions. While some platforms support creator economies, balancing revenue generation with accessibility remains a delicate task. Ensuring that creative tools remain affordable and inclusive is essential to sustaining diverse and active communities.

Pros and Cons Overview

  • Pros: Encourages creativity, fosters community, supports learning, offers endless replayability.
  • Cons: Steep learning curves, potential for toxic content, reliance on internet connectivity, occasional performance issues on lower-end devices.
